Some Things You Should Know About The Jet Ski

A Jet ski is a personal watercraft vehicle that can accomodate 1 - 4 persons depending on the model. They were first developed by Yamaha as a one person model, and their popularity has caused other companies to join the booming market for similar watercrafts. The original design had the rider standing or crouching on a small platform towards the rear of the craft. The rider could vary his or her position with a steering column the could move vertically up and down. This aided in variable standing positions as well as letting the rider move with wave action as necessary.

The most notable innovation that came with the Jet Ski design was the jet propulsion system that it incorporated. The Jet Ski was powered bringing water into a tube and pushing out of the rear, thus createing the “jet” effect. This is done by a impeller inside the tube. The tube can also be moved side to side horizontally for steering purposes. This power system is ideal for small watercrafts because it is safe and fast. There is no external propeller or rudder for passengers to worry about. The jet drive is also a very quick means of accelleration for light watercrafts.

Since the first Jet Ski gained huge popularity, the other designs have almost completely replaced the original design. All personal watercrafts still use the same jet propulsion, but the body design is very different. Newer designs are larger and they use a motorcycle style seat that is much more comfortable for cruising and it easily fits more than one passenger. depending on the length of the seat, you can fit 1 - 4 passengers comfortably. The first design of this watercraft was called the WaveRunner and it was made for 2 persons. Modern designs average room for 3 persons because the Jet Ski has now become an alternative to a boat because of its versatility and low price tag.

So You Want To Climb A Colorado “Fourteener”

Have you caught the bug yet? The desire to climb a mountain with a summit rising at least 14,000 feet above sea level has reached near-epidemic proportions in Colorado, with estimates of roughly 500,000 hikers and climbers making their way up a Fourteener each year.

The good news is that a number of Colorado’s 54 Fourteeners can be climbed by anyone with good stamina and overall fitness. That’s also the bad news. People who know little about the special risks of hiking in the mountains often set out along a well-marked and well-traveled trail up a Fourteener ill-equipped for the venture. Hypothermia and dehydration are two of the dangerous and all-too-common problems that might await hikers who aren’t prepared.

It was the Fourth of July weekend, and we headed to the mountains, escaping Denver’s 95 degree heat. As we approached the summit above tree-line (trees can’t grow above a certain elevation; in Colorado that elevation is around 11,000 to 12,000 feet), it began to snow. Hard. And blow. Harder. We donned our wind pants and warm coats, hats and gloves, and continued to the top.

There we found a hiker who had passed us on the trail earlier in the day. He was dressed in running shorts and a light shirt, wearing tennis shoes (which were quite wet by now), and carrying a small, empty water bottle. He was shivering violently. People began bundling him up in their extra warm clothing, giving him food and water, and then helped him back down the trail.

Here are a few basic “rules” to remember before heading up that mountain trail (even when hiking up peaks lower than 14,000 feet):

1. Bring along extra layers of clothing. No matter how beautiful and warm the weather is when you start out, temperatures can plummet and you can get soaked if a thunderstorm moves in.

2. Thunderstorms are extremely common in Colorado’s mountains during summer afternoons. Plan your day so you can be leaving the summit and heading back down the trail no later than noon. Watch the sky for cloud build-up, and turn around earlier if a storm seems to be forming early.

3. Carry plenty of water, and drink frequently. Even in cool weather, you’ll probably need to drink a minimum of 2 quarts of water during your hike to and from the summit of one of the “easier” Fourteeners. That amount of water is on the low side for many people.

4. Some of the other “essentials” to bring along: food (snack frequently - don’t let yourself run out of “fuel”), map & compass (and know how to use them), fire starter, flashlight or headlamp, 1st Aid kit, sunglasses, and sunscreen.

5. Hike with a buddy. That cold, wet guy was lucky that other people came along to help him. Imagine what would have happened if he had been alone for another 30 minutes!

These tips are just a start to help you hike more safely in the mountains. Consider joining a hiking club before tackling higher peaks in Colorado. You’ll find some new hiking partners, learn more outdoor skills, and probably have a great time to boot.

FIFA World Cup - A History 1930 to 1958

If the number of television viewers watching a sporting event is any guide to its popularity, then the FIFA World Cup is the world’s favorite, with an estimated viewer ship of nearly 30 billion. How very different from the early days.

In the early 20th century, the only tournament where national teams could compete, albeit on an amateur basis was as part of the Olympic Games. The Federation Internationale de Football Association (FIFA) recognized the Olympic tournament as a “world football championship for amateurs” in 1914 and undertook to organize the event under the Olympic umbrella.

Due to the First World War the introduction of the FIFA organized event was delayed until the 1920 Summer Olympics. Belgium won the tournament that year with Uruguay winning the next two titles in 1924 and 1928. During the early planning stages of the 1932 Summer Olympics the International Olympic Committee decided to drop the football tournament because of the low popularity of football in the United States. In response, Jules Rimet, the then President of FIFA passed a vote initiating a tournament to be held in 1930 totally under FIFA’ s control. Thus the World Cup was born. 1930 To honor its 100th birthday and to acknowledge the fact that it had won the last two Olympic competitions, Uruguay was chosen as the first host of the World Cup. Only four European teams took part despite Uruguay’s willingness to pay travel expenses.

The first match was France versus Mexico. Less than 1000 fans turned up to see the French win 4-1. In another match, again involving France, but this time against Argentina, the referee set the depressing pattern of poor decisions in the World Cup by ending the game over six minutes early. The ensuing invasion of the pitch by the Argentinean fans persuaded the referee to play the extra six minutes once the pitch had been cleared. Just as well for Argentina. They won 1-0. The final was a real grudge-match between Uruguay and Argentina. They couldn’t even agree on what type of ball to use so a compromise was reached where a different ball was used for each half of the match. Over 90,000 fans watched Uruguay become the first World Cup Champions by beating Argentina 4-2.

Statistics Host Country: Uruguay

Countries: Argentina, Belgium, Bolivia, Brazil, Chile, France, Mexico, Paraguay, Peru, Romania, United States, Uruguay and Yugoslavia.

Final: Uruguay 4, Argentina 2

Top scorer: Guillermo Stabile, Argentina (8)

1934 On to Benito Mussolini’s fascist Italy for the 1934 World Cup. The Italians didn’t offer traveling expenses so the previous champions Uruguay so they chose not to defend their title. The USA in their second World Cup suffered a 7-1 defeat at the hands of the eventual winners Italy who beat Czechoslovakia 2-1 after extra time.

Statistics Host Country: Italy

Countries: Argentina, Austria, Belgium, Brazil, Czechoslovakia, Egypt, France, Germany, Hungary, Italy, Netherlands, Romania,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land, United States

Final: Italy 2, Czechoslovakia 1 (after extra time)

Top goal scorer (Joint) : Conen, Germany, Oldrich Nejedly, Czechoslovakia, Angelo Schiavio, Italy (4)

1938 With war clouds heavy over Europe the World Cup moved to France. Italy were the favorites but their future allies Germany fancied their chances. The Germans, who had recently annexed Austria invited the Austrian players to choose to play for either Austria or Germany. Six of the Austrians chose to play for Germany. It wasn’t a good move as Switzerland knocked Germany out in the first round. The Italians cruised to the final, beating France and Brazil on the way. Hungary were no match for them in the final itself, Italy winning 4-2.

Statistics

1938

Host Country: France

Countries: Belgium, Brazil, Cuba, Czechoslovakia, Dutch East Indies , France, Germany, Hungary, Italy, Netherlands, Norway, Poland, Romania, Sweden, Switzerland

Final: Italy 4, Hungary 2

Top goal scorer: Leonidas da Silva, Brazil (8) The Second World War After 1939 the world had more important matters to think about other than football and Italy kept the World Cup Trophy under the bed of Ottorino Barassi, the Italian vice president of FIFA, who feared it would be a prime target for Nazis. Thankfully this action kept the trophy safe and in 1946 as a tribute to Jules Rimet, whose initiative led to the creation of the World Cup Competition, the trophy was officially named The Jules Rimet Trophy. As most of Europe lay in ruins and the world’s economies were devastated by the war the next World Cup competition did not take place until 1950.

1950 After a twelve-year lay off, the World Cup competition returned to South America, this time Brazil. The lack of participating countries caused the organizers a headache so the format was changed. Instead of a final Brazil, Spain, Sweden and Uruguay played in a league format that ended with Brazil just needing a draw in its final game to win the cup. But it was not to be. Brazil’s opponents spoiled the party by winning 2-1.

Statistics Host Country: Brazil

Countries: Bolivia, Brazil, Chile, England, Italy, Mexico, Paraguay,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land, United States, Uruguay, Yugoslavia

Final: Uruguay 2, Brazil 1

Top goal scorer: Ademir de Menezes, Brazil (9)

1954 This was the first World Cup to be televised and the few people with television sets in those days were treated to a feast of goals, the average being 5.38 per game. Some of the highest scoring games were - Hungary 9 South Korea 0, Hungary 8 West Germany 3, (a group stage match that the West German coach wanted to lose to avoid meeting Brazil too early) and West Germany 7 Turkey 2. The highest scoring match in World Cup history took place during this competition. It was the quarter final where Austria beat Switzerland 7-5. The final was a re-match of the earlier game West Germany versus Hungary. This time the West German coach Sepp Herberger fielded his strongest side and beat Hungary 3-2

Statistics Host Country: Switzerland

Countries: Austria, Czechoslovakia, Belgium, Brazil, England, France, Hungary, Italy, Mexico, Scotland, South Korea, Switzerland, Turkey, Uruguay, West Germany, Yugoslavia

Final: West Germany 3, Hungary 2

Top goal scorer: Sandor Kocsis, Hungary (11)

1958 Again in Europe, this time Sweden, the 1958 World Cup saw the debut on the world stage of a 17 year old Brazilian destined to become the most famous footballer in the world - Pele. He scored a total of six goals in the tournament including three in the final against hosts Sweden that Brazil won 5-2.

Statistics

Host Country: Sweden

Countries: Argentina, Austria, Brazil, Czechoslovakia, England, France, Hungary, Mexico, Northern Ireland, Paraguay, Scotland, Sweden, USSR, West Germany, Wales, Yugoslavia

Final: Brazil 5, Sweden 2

Top goal scorer: Just Fontaine, France (13) Still the record

Close Match between MySpace and Facebook

MySpace, co-founded by Dewolfe, has been receiving a lot of bad press lately. Management of high level are leaving, its main rival, Facebook is expanding dramatically while MySpace is running flat, word on the street that Google will withdraw from an advertising contract that takes up 40% of MySpace’s revenues. That’s why DeWolfe is eager to find out new strategies to give MySpace’s revenues a boost. For example, the MySpace Music which has been launched for one year, will have the new feature of selling concert tickets and band merchandise online. Its game offerings are also upgrading, “virtual” merchandise such as cupcakes can be purchased for visitor’s friends and loved ones. The new focus of MySpace and improving 2.0 MySpace Layouts will be increasing the revenues rather than attracting more new users. “I don’t know Facebook’s profitability,” DeWolfe says. “But if I could have 300 million people using MySpace or be profitable, I would take profitability.”

DeWolfe claims MySpace is profitable. But News Corp thinks that spending on new features and the international expansion has been too much that it dwarfs earnings. Meanwhile, Wall Street has not been impressed a lot by MySpace last year. Analysts predict that once Google withdraws from the advertising contract, it’s not going to be easy for MySpace to find another search engine which can pay as much as Google.

MySpace, with 126 million unique visitors worldwide is relatively small compared with its chief rival, Facebook, which has 236 million in January. However, MySpace does have some advantages in the U.S. market. The visitors of MySpace spend more time on the site than those of Facebook. According to a report from a tracking firm ComSore Media Metric, advertisers prefer visitors spending more time because they will be able to see their ads. DeWolfe is not yet satisfied, he is implementing several new ways to hold the visitors a little longer such as more six-minute shows and new video games. However, visitors hanging around the site longer can not guarantee that MySpace’s revenues from selling ads will increase. When the economy is in its downturn, online display marketing has been hit the most. Michael Nathanson, a senior analyst from Sanford C. Bernstein, is not optimistic about MySpace’s future. A 4% decline in ads sales is possible according to Michael.

There is no doubt that “hyper-targeted” ads are most attractive to advertisers nowadays. It is only natural that MySpace is employing this marketing method as many other online media companies did. Target group can be as accurate as 18-50 women who like Gucci and live in Australia. Sony, McDonald’s and Toyota are all potential buyers of these hyper-targeted ads. One thing that its rival Facebook doesn’t offer advertisers is the “home-page takeover”, which is really popular among advertisers according to Debra Aho Williamson, a senior analyst with the market research firm eMarketer. Rumors are that contracts for two founders of MySpace at News Corp may not be renewed.
